  • Provides back-up and support to BHP’s computer networking system. Uses diagnostic testing software and equipment and identifies causes of networking problems.
  • Installs hardware, and troubleshoots and resolves hardware problems, including desktop and laptop computers, and telephone systems. Installs, activates and troubleshoots wireless devices.
  • Develops and maintains expertise and current working knowledge of BHP software, including its operating systems, Microsoft Office applications, electronic client records software, and other job software.
  • Assists in providing new hire training so employees regarding software and hardware they’ll be using on the job.
  • Maintains a functioning data backup system to protect critical data in accordance with BHP’s data backup plan.
  • Provides support for BHP’s password policies controlling and providing security for accessing network, software, electronic client files, and other protected files.
  • Maintains the security of email, voice and other electronic communications, and configures security settings or access permissions for individuals and groups.
  • Provides coverage as part of a team for 24/7 HelpDesk response. Answers user inquiries, troubleshoots, responds to, and resolves IT issues interfering with staff’s ability to complete their job tasks.
  • Documents network support activities.
  • Works with IT contractors and software and hardware support technicians to resolve difficult problems, and provide the best possible technology experience for employees.
  • Maintains confidentiality of HIPPA and other confidential and sensitive information.
  • Maintains the highest level of integrity and professionalism in all aspects of job performance.
  • Keeps abreast of current trends and “best practices” in the field. Attends and participates in required trainings on topics relevant to the job and to behavioral healthcare.
  • Performs job responsibilities and maintains all records in accordance with BHP’s policy, procedure and protocol, and as appropriate to the job, all regulatory authorities’ accreditation/licensure/ certification standards, and all applicable laws and regulations.
  • Works assigned schedule, exhibits regular and punctual attendance and works outside of normal schedule as required.

KEY PERFORMANCE INDICATORS

The employee assigned to this position is responsible for achieving each of the following key performance indicators (KPI’s) to the specified standard. The employee is likewise accountable for consistently meeting or exceeding all of this job’s essential duties to performance standards as are evaluated throughout the course of employment, and which are rated during the performance evaluation period.

  1. All HelpDesk requests are responded to within 8 business hours.
  2. All troubleshooting and work performed to resolve IT related issues is properly documented in the IT ticketing system.
  3. Any and all deficiencies found related to data security, network infrastructure, and IT related solutions are reported in writing to the Director of Information Technology in a timely manner.
  4. Routinely performs on-site technical assessment visits to all BHP locations to visually check all equipment and help staff to report as yet unreported IT related issues.

REQUIRED K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ILIITIES

Knowledge of: basic information technology; basic computer hardware and networking; job software applications; telephone systems; network security and data backup; HIPAA and other confidentiality requirements.

Ability to: effectively respond to and provide technical assistance to end-users; develop expertise and current working knowledge of BHP software, including its operating systems, Microsoft Office applications, electronic client records software, and other job software; be self-directed; develop and maintain effective working relationships with coworkers and other job contacts; demonstrate respect and sensitivity for cultural and personal differences; contribute toward building a positive and productive team working environment; maintain confidentiality of confidential and sensitive information; consistently exhibit job competency, ethical conduct, integrity and trustworthiness; embrace and effectively adapt to organizational change; exhibit behavior and conduct consistent with BHP values and policies.

Skill in:  troubleshooting and resolving networking, software, hardware and other IT problems; maintain work records; training end-users on software applications and use of computer hardware and peripherals.
